Taxonomic Classification

Rank Blue Mason Bee Dusky melanomys
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Megachilidae Cricetidae
Genus Osmia Melanomys
Species Osmia caerulescens Melanomys caliginosus

Evolutionary Relationship

Blue Mason Bee and Dusky melanomys share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
